What is the required contact time for bleach to be effective?

5 minutes

10 minutes

For bleach to effectively disinfect surfaces, it typically requires a contact time of at least 10 minutes. This duration allows the active ingredients in bleach to penetrate and inactivate pathogens, including bacteria and viruses, ensuring that potential contaminants are sufficiently eliminated.

While shorter contact times may not allow for complete disinfection, extending the contact time beyond 10 minutes does not significantly enhance efficacy and could lead to issues such as damage to certain surfaces. Therefore, understanding the optimal contact time is crucial for effective sanitation practices.
